Sygnity to face competition from former employees

Utilis IT, founded by the former employees of IT company Winuel from the Sygnity group, is planning to look for clients in the energy segment – a key base for Sygnity.

The firm was established by a few dozen former employees after the founders of Winuel were dismissed from management board positions. Sygnity sells proprietary solutions to the energy sector and it achieves high margins on these projects.

Due to this, in theory Utilis might win over some clients from Sygnity after it starts its operations on February 1, but for the time being it is recruiting from within the former employer.

This is not the first such dangerous situation for Sygnity, as it has already faced two similar cases in the past and, according to Parkiet, it suffered from the decisions of its former employees to set up their own companies.

Source: Parkiet
